Problem summary

  • Enhance the SHA1PRNG SecureRandom functionality for the IBMJCE
    and IBMSecureRandom providers to support a customizable source
    for seed data.  Introduce new SecureRandom implementations which
    use a mix of blocking and non-blocking system calls to generate
    cryptographically secure random numbers and seed values.
    

Problem conclusion

  • The SHA1PRNG implementation for the IBMJCE and IBMSecureRandom
    providers has been updated to support a customizable source for
    seed data. By default, an attempt is made to use the entropy
    gathering device that is specified by the securerandom.source
    security property in the java.security file. The entropy
    gathering device can also be specified with the system property
    java.security.egd. Specifying this system property overrides the
    securerandom.source security property.
    For operating systems like AIX  and Linux, three new
    SecureRandom implementations that provide a mix of blocking and
    non-blocking behavior are introduced for the IBMJCE provider.
    The new implementations that have been added are NativePRNG,
    NativePRNGBlocking, and NativePRNGNonBlocking.
    The java.security file has been updated to specify a default
    value of ?file:/dev/urandom? for the ?securerandom.source?
    Security property.
    NOTE:  The performance and quality of randomness of obtaining
    seed material by SHA1PRNG is dependent on the configured source
    for seed data.  Better quality random data may be obtained on
    some systems by using /dev/random over /dev/urandom, although
    performance may be strongly impacted as the system might block
    until sufficiently random bytes can be returned.  Performance
    may also be affected if the seed source is undefined, in which
    case will cause the traditional system/thread activity algorithm
    to be used.  Users who use their own customized java.security
    file should ensure that they are specifying an appropriate seed
    source and also be aware that earlier Java versions had the
    ?securerandom.source? Security property unset, set to
    ?file:/dev/random? or set to ?file:/dev/urandom?.
    For more information, refer to the IBM SDK documentation.
